Mewujudkan Aplikasi untuk Peranti Mudah Alih
Pemaju dan coder amatur sering terintimidasi dengan pelbagai isu yang mengelilingi perkembangan aplikasi untuk peranti mudah alih. Syukurlah, teknologi canggih yang tersedia untuk kita hari ini, menjadikannya agak mudah dalam membuat aplikasi mudah alih. Artikel ini memberi tumpuan kepada cara membuat aplikasi mudah alih merentasi pelbagai platform mudah alih.
Mewujudkan aplikasi mudah alih
Bagaimana anda membuat aplikasi mudah alih pertama anda? Aspek pertama yang perlu anda lihat di sini ialah saiz penggunaan yang anda hendak buat dan platform yang anda ingin gunakan. Dalam artikel ini, kami berurusan dengan mewujudkan aplikasi mudah alih untuk Windows, Pocket PC dan Smartphone.
Baca terus untuk ….
02 dari 06Mewujudkan Aplikasi Bergerak Windows Pertama Anda
Windows Mobile adalah platform yang kuat yang membolehkan pemaju membuat aplikasi yang pelbagai untuk meningkatkan pengalaman pengguna. Memiliki Windows CE 5.0 sebagai asasnya, Windows Mobile dibungkus dalam banyak ciri yang termasuk fungsi shell dan komunikasi. Mewujudkan aplikasi Windows Mobile menjadi mudah untuk pemaju aplikasi - hampir semudah membuat aplikasi desktop.
Windows Mobile kini telah memudar, memberi laluan kepada Windows Phone 7 dan platform mudah alih Windows Phone 8 yang paling baru, yang telah menarik minat pemaju aplikasi dan pengguna mudah alih.
Apa yang anda perlukan
Anda memerlukan perkara berikut untuk mula membuat aplikasi mudah alih anda:
- Visual Studio 2005 atau 2008: Program hebat ini membolehkan anda membuat, mengarang, debug dan membentangkan aplikasi anda, semuanya dari satu platform tunggal. Antara muka mudah difahami dan digunakan juga.
- Windows Mobile SDK: Alat berguna ini mengandungi header dan fail perpustakaan API yang penting untuk mengakses kefungsian Windows Mobile. Ia juga memberi anda aplikasi sampel, emulator debug dan dokumentasi.
- Pusat AktifSync atau Windows Mobile Device: Active Sync dan Pusat Peranti Windows Mobile membantu dalam menggerakkan aplikasi ke emulator atau peranti. Walaupun Windows XP berfungsi dengan Active Sync, Windows Vista dilengkapi dengan Pusat Peranti Windows Bergerak.
Alat yang boleh anda gunakan untuk menulis data pada Windows Mobile
Visual Studio menawarkan anda semua alat yang diperlukan untuk membina aplikasi dalam kod asli, kod terurus atau gabungan dua bahasa ini. Marilah kita melihat alat yang boleh anda gunakan untuk menulis data untuk membuat aplikasi Windows Mobile.
Kod Native, iaitu, Visual C ++ - memberi anda akses perkakasan langsung dan prestasi tinggi, dengan jejak kecil. Ini ditulis dalam bahasa "asli" yang digunakan oleh komputer yang dijalankan dan dilaksanakan secara langsung oleh pemproses.
Kod asli hanya boleh digunakan untuk menjalankan aplikasi yang tidak diurus - semua data mesti dikompil semula sekiranya anda beralih ke OS lain.
Kod terurus, iaitu Visual C # atau Visual Basic .NET - boleh digunakan untuk membuat pelbagai jenis aplikasi antara muka pengguna dan memberi akses pemaju ke data dan perkhidmatan Web dengan menggunakan Microsoft SQL Server 2005 Compact Edition.
Pendekatan ini menyelesaikan banyak masalah pengekodan yang terdapat dalam C ++, sementara juga menguruskan memori, emulasi dan penyahpepijatan, yang paling penting untuk menulis aplikasi yang lebih maju, rumit yang mensasarkan perisian dan penyelesaian perusahaan perniagaan.
ASP.NET boleh ditulis menggunakan Visual Studio .NET, C # dan J #. Kawalan Bergerak ASP.NET berkesan untuk digunakan pada beberapa peranti menggunakan set kod tunggal, seperti juga jika anda memerlukan jalur lebar data yang dijamin untuk peranti anda.
Walaupun ASP.NET membantu anda menargetkan pelbagai peranti, kelemahan adalah bahawa ia akan berfungsi hanya apabila peranti klien disambungkan ke pelayan. Oleh itu, ini tidak sesuai untuk mengumpul data klien untuk kemudian menyegerakkannya dengan pelayan atau untuk aplikasi yang terus menggunakan peranti untuk mengendalikan data.
API Data Google membantu pemaju mengakses dan mengurus semua data yang berkaitan dengan perkhidmatan Google. Memandangkan ini berdasarkan protokol piawai seperti HTTP dan XML, coder boleh mencipta dan membina aplikasi mudah untuk platform Windows Mobile.
Langkah berikut membantu anda membuat aplikasi Windows Mobile kosong: Buka Visual Studio dan pergi ke Fail> Baru> Projek. Kembangkan Panel Jenis Projek dan pilih Peranti Pintar. Pergi ke panel Templat, pilih Projek Peranti Pintar dan tekan OK. Pilih Peranti Aplikasi di sini dan klik OK. Tahniah! Anda baru membuat projek pertama anda. Kotak Kotak Alat membolehkan anda bermain-main dengan banyak ciri. Semak setiap butang drag-and-drop ini untuk mendapatkan lebih banyak kesamaan dengan cara program berfungsi. Langkah seterusnya melibatkan menjalankan aplikasi anda pada peranti Windows Mobile. Sambungkan peranti ke desktop, tekan kekunci F5, pilih emulator atau peranti untuk menggunakannya dan pilih OK. Sekiranya semuanya berjalan lancar, anda akan melihat aplikasi anda berjalan dengan lancar.
Membuat aplikasi untuk Telefon Pintar adalah serupa dengan peranti Windows Mobile. Tetapi anda perlu terlebih dahulu memahami peranti anda. Telefon pintar mempunyai ciri yang sama dengan PDA, jadi mereka mempunyai ciri-ciri butang hantar dan tamat. Kunci belakang digunakan untuk fungsi backspace dan penyemak imbas. Perkara terbaik mengenai peranti ini adalah kunci lembut, yang boleh diprogramkan. Anda boleh menggunakan ciri ini untuk membuat pelbagai fungsi.Butang pusat juga bertindak sebagai butang "Enter". Catatan: Anda perlu memasang SmartPhone 2003 SDK untuk menulis aplikasi telefon pintar menggunakan Visual Studio .NET 2003. Di sini datang bahagian yang sukar. Dengan ketiadaan kawalan butang dalam pegang tangan skrin sentuh, anda perlu memilih kawalan alternatif, seperti menu. Visual Studio memberikan anda kawalan MainMenu, yang boleh disesuaikan. Tetapi terlalu banyak pilihan menu peringkat tinggi akan menyebabkan sistem crash. Apa yang anda boleh lakukan adalah untuk membuat beberapa menu peringkat teratas dan memberi pelbagai pilihan di bawah masing-masing. Membangun aplikasi untuk BlackBerry OS adalah perniagaan besar hari ini. Untuk menulis apl BlackBerry, anda perlu mempunyai: Gerhana berfungsi dengan baik dengan pengaturcaraan JAVA. Projek baru, yang difailkan dengan pelanjutan COC, boleh dimuat secara langsung ke simulator. Anda kemudian boleh menguji apl dengan memuatkannya melalui Pengurus Peranti atau dengan menggunakan pilihan baris perintah "Javaloader". Catatan: Tidak semua BlackBerry API akan berfungsi untuk semua telefon pintar BlackBerry. Oleh itu perhatikan peranti yang menerima kod tersebut.
Membuat aplikasi untuk Pocket PC serupa dengan peranti di atas. Perbezaan di sini ialah peranti menggunakan Rangka Kerja Kompak. NET, yang lebih daripada sepuluh kali lebih ringan daripada versi Windows penuh dan juga menawarkan pemaju ciri, kawalan dan sokongan perkhidmatan Web. Keseluruhan pakej boleh disimpan dalam fail CAB kecil dan dipasang secara langsung pada peranti sasaran anda - ini berfungsi lebih cepat dan lebih mudah. Sebaik sahaja anda telah belajar membuat aplikasi peranti mudah alih asas, anda perlu meneruskan lagi dan cuba meningkatkan pengetahuan anda. Inilah caranya: Bina dan Jalankan Aplikasi Bergerak Windows Pertama Anda
Mewujudkan Aplikasi untuk Telefon Pintar
Bagaimana jika telefon pintar mempunyai skrin sentuh?
Menulis aplikasi untuk telefon pintar BlackBerry
Membuat Aplikasi untuk Pocket PC
Apa selepas ini?
Mewujudkan Aplikasi untuk Sistem Mudah Alih yang Berbeza